Output d876eb3997204154a115c1946f8151817d26e07edca9789b06224ccaa8314d68:1

value
957469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cfa94e9221e222054c82e8dcde6894902af6f28 OP_EQUAL
address
38i3TqsQ6gKYBTpTewiowF8d9Go8Q6mFTy
transaction
d876eb3997204154a115c1946f8151817d26e07edca9789b06224ccaa8314d68
confirmations
148983
spent
true